Hunter’s most powerful controller for command of large and sophisticated sites
The ACC brings the convenience and versatility of modularity to the most advanced controller the company has ever created. The adaptable modular design not only allows configuration to the number of stations you desire, it also makes it easy to upgrade to true 2-way communication with a Hunter central control system. Customize your controller in the field with the features you need: plug-in modules add stations and add central control communication capability. But what truly sets the ACC apart are its many features, most notably real-time flow sensing. This feature allows the controller to dynamically respond to flow changes by station and track system water use. The ACC also boasts a total of 6 independent and 4 custom programs and the unique ability to assist the water manager in conforming to “watering windows.” Plus, the ACC’s large backlit LCD display offers the user a convenient means to personalize on-screen station and program names.
FEATURES & BENEFITS
Real-time flow monitoring in standalone mode
Learns flow by station and automatically responds to incorrect flow
Stations expand with plug-in modules
Provides easy addition of more stations and simplified inventory management
Easy modular upgrade to 2-way communication with central control
Simple plug-in modules upgrade ACC to hardwire, modem, or radio control
6 fully-independent programs (plus 4 custom programs)
Standard programs each have separate day cycles and 10 start times, offering total flexibility for complex landscapes
Independent day schedule options for each program
Maximum scheduling choices (select days of the week, true odd/even days, skip days up to 31 days)
Non-volatile 100-year memory
Program data is retained during power outages, no battery required
Cycle and Soak capability by station
Allows run times to be divided into repeat cycles to minimize runoff
Remote control ready
Pre-wired to directly accept Hunter ICR remote control—plug and go!
Watering Window Manager™
User defines hours when no watering is allowed; will override any user-set programs that enter that time frame
Multiple sensor capability
Works with Hunter Solar Sync sensor for automatic smart weather adjustment and up to 4 (four) Clik sensors for rain, freeze and wind shutdowns

SPECIFICATIONS & FEATURES
• Transformer input: 120/230VAC, 50/60Hz; 2A at 120VAC, 1A at 230VAC, Maximum
• Transformer output: 24VAC, 4A, 110VA
• Station output: 24VAC, 0.56A (2 valves)
• Maximum total output: 24VAC, 4A (14 valves), includes master valve circuits
• Two master valve outputs: 24VAC, 0.28A each
• Seasonal adjustment: 0 to 300% in 1% increments, by program
• All programs can run simultaneously
• Self-diagnostic circuit breaker: skips shorted stations and continues watering
• Station run times: 1 second minimum to 6 hours maximum
• Programmable delay between stations of up to 4 hours
• UL, C-UL, CE, C-tick
• 365 day calendar
• Test program feature allows for quick system checks
• Central control compatible with Hunter IMMS™ system
• Upgrade to "smart" weather based watering with Solar Sync Sensor
• Real-time Flow Monitoring capability built in, with actual flow histories (in GPM or metric) available when connected to Hunter HFS or other compatible flow meters.
• Flow-learning mode by station, with station-level diagnostics and alarm shutdowns.
• Easy Retrieve™ backup feature can restore schedules, run times, names and other settings to a saved setup
• Programmable Stack and Overlap settings, including SmartStack™.
• Alphanumeric names up to 13 characters for each program, station (zone) or group, with programmable customer contact screen.

ACC Update Instructions
You will need the following to complete the update:
- USB cable, A/B type. This standard USB cable has a flat end (for the computer) and a rounded square end, for the facepack
- A pen or something pointy to press the Reset button on the facepack
- An ACC Bootloader Update File on a computer.
Download and install ACC Facepack update to your PC before you flash the Facepack
